最近几天在学习一个微服务项目的开发,其中服务器中用到了docker容器去安装mysql等环境。第一次学习的时候一切顺利,但第二天继续学习的时候发现navicat不能连接虚拟机上的mysql数据库了,然后在shell中看到了标题中的错误:ERROR 2002 (HY000): Can't connect to local MySQL serve
转载 2024-10-24 08:03:46
29阅读
502 Bad Gateway服务器作为网关或者代理时,为了完成请求访问下一个服务器,但该服务器返回了非法的应答。 解决办法是:再刷新一下网页或清理一下电脑的缓冲文件在打开你想打开的网页就好了. 一般情况下,这种办法是行得通的,但也不排除你所访问的网页被屏蔽的可能,如果你所访问的网页被屏蔽的话,就不管你怎么刷新也是没用的了。1.什么是502 bad gateway 报错简单来说502是报错类型代码
转载 2023-12-04 22:54:33
1657阅读
********************************************************** Spring MVC found on classpath, which is incompatible with Spring Cloud Gateway at this time
转载 2020-02-09 19:19:00
264阅读
2评论
# CentOS Docker-Compose 报错 502 Bad Gateway 解决方案 ## 引言 在使用 DockerDocker Compose 进行应用部署时,有时可能会遇到 "502 Bad Gateway" 错误,这通常是由于后端服务无法正常响应或配置不正确所导致的。本文将指导您如何解决这个问题。 ## 解决方案概述 解决 "502 Bad Gateway" 错误的过程
原创 2023-08-24 15:34:09
1314阅读
查找文件文件名root@ubuntu:~# find / -name "keepalived.service" /data/softs/keepalived-2.2.4/keepalived/keepalived.service /usr/lib/systemd/system/keepalived.service 安装所有应用都在data下边服务在/data/server下边相关配置文件
转载 2023-06-13 13:37:59
1982阅读
# Docker网关:简化容器网络通信的解决方案 在容器化的应用程序环境中,容器之间的通信是一个重要的问题。为了实现容器之间的相互访问,我们需要一种简单而高效的网络通信解决方案。Docker网关就是这样一种解决方案,它提供了一种简单的方式来管理容器之间的通信。 ## Docker网关的基本概念 Docker网关是一个中间代理,它负责转发容器之间的网络请求。它可以看作是一个虚拟的网络交换机,负
原创 2023-10-17 04:03:25
177阅读
使用API Gateway处理微服务请求转发、合并前面两篇Docker微服务的服务发现以及Docker微服务的服务间通信机制。主要介绍了如何解决微服务的服务发现和通信问题。 在微服务的架构体系中,为了减少服务间的耦合,在划分服务间的限界上下文的时候。会尽量减少微服务之间的 调用。在实际的需求场景中,往往要同时请求多个微服务资源。 解耦微服务的调用如下面一个场景,”用户订单列表“的一个聚合页面,需
前言:最近项目上需要用到这个技术,但是真正集成到SpringCloud项目运行时,遇到各种问题。查了很多博客也没有一篇相对完整的,大多数是demo代码。下面将完整地分享从 Client-->Nginx-->gateway-->server 到返回的整个功能实现。一、基本概念1.websocket基础概念WebSocket是一种通信协议,可在单个TCP连接上进行全双工通信。WebS
转载 2024-01-10 23:04:39
238阅读
# Docker 设置GatewayDocker中,网络是一个非常重要的概念。每个Docker容器都有自己的网络环境,包括IP地址、子网、网关等。在某些情况下,我们可能需要手动设置容器的网关信息,以确保容器能够正确地与外部网络通信。本文将介绍如何在Docker容器中设置网关信息,并提供相关的代码示例。 ## 什么是网关? 在计算机网络中,网关是连接两个网络的设备,它充当数据包在两个网络之
原创 2024-04-03 05:04:53
139阅读
一、Web应用开发背景使用Java做Web应用开发已经有近20年的历史了,从最初的Servlet1.0一步步演化到现在如此多的框架、库以及整个生态系统。经过这么长时间的发展,Java作为一个成熟的语言,也演化出了非常成熟的生态系统,这也是许多公司采用Java作为主流的语言进行服务器端开发的原因,也是为什么Java一直保持着非常活跃的用户群体的原因。 最受Java开发者喜好的框架当属Sp
转载 7月前
13阅读
# Docker安装Gateway ## 简介 在现代微服务架构中,网关(Gateway)被广泛应用于实现微服务的访问控制、负载均衡、安全性等功能。Docker是一种流行的容器化技术,通过将应用程序及其依赖项封装在容器中,实现了更高效的部署和管理。本文将介绍如何使用Docker安装和配置一个简单的网关。 ## 安装Docker 在开始之前,我们首先需要安装DockerDocker提供了适
原创 2023-12-05 06:43:36
214阅读
# Docker配置Gateway ## 简介 在Docker中配置gateway是为了实现容器与外部网络的通信,包括访问外部网络和容器间的通信。本文将介绍如何使用Docker配置gateway的步骤和相关代码。 ## 整体流程 下面是配置Docker gateway的整体流程: ``` 步骤 | 说明 ------------|------------------------
原创 2023-08-16 13:42:46
678阅读
今天,我的VPS提示Nginx 502 Bad Gateway错误了,很烦。我什么事情都没做呀,有点想不通,怎么这次就出现了502 Bad Gateway?郁闷啊!在搜索了一下,发现一篇文库文档,终于找到了不少相关的答案,希望修改之后不会再出现这个错误了。现在写出来,给大家一个参考。 首先我ping网站能通,DNS解析也是正常的,反问html网页是正常的,但是访问php就有问题,说明问题出在P
转载 2024-05-27 17:25:13
208阅读
发生原因 1、PHP FastCGI进程数不够用 当网站并发访问巨大时,php fastcgi的进程数不有一定的保障,因为cgi是单线程多进程工作的,也就是说cgi需要处理完一个页面后再继续下一个页面。如果进程数不够,当访问巨大的时候,cgi按排队处理之前的请求,之后的请求只有被放弃。这个时候nginx就会不时的出现502错误。 2、PHP FastCGI的内存不够用 当nginx返回静态页面时
转载 2024-05-11 22:38:18
103阅读
目录预环境说明nodejs环境搭建【任选其一,推荐使用插件】Centos的Nodejs安装和环境变量设置Jenkins安装和配置nodejs插件Jenkins配置vue项目进行发布遇到的问题预环境说明Jenkins的环境搭建可以参考下面的链接,在此基础上执行vue项目的持续集成发布。Jenkins - 单机和集群搭建、基于git分支部署spring boot项目(脚本、docker发布)、gitl
转载 2024-03-09 17:15:35
153阅读
输入命令:curl -fsSL https://get.docker.com | bash -s docker --mirror Aliyun具体报错如图:经过不断分析和尝试,发现解决办法:(参
原创 2022-04-18 14:42:53
848阅读
一、webSocket简介webSocket长连接是一种在单个tcp连接上进行全双工通信的协议,允许双向数据推送。一般微服务提供的restful API只是对前端请求做出相应。使用webSocket可以实现后端主动向前端推送消息。二、网关配置spring cloud 的网关组件有zuul和getway1、getway配置网关的时候注意添加ws协议spring: cloud: gatew
转载 2023-10-10 23:40:51
120阅读
java.lang.IllegalArgumentException: When allowCredentials is true, allowedOrigins cannot contain the special value "*" since that cannot be set on the "Access-Control-Allow-Origin" response header.
原创 2021-09-01 15:36:09
8532阅读
postman 发送请求报错:504 Gateway Time-out出现这个问题,可能的远远。1、服
原创 2023-02-27 19:31:29
1180阅读
java.lang.IllegalArgumentException: When allowCredentials is true, allowedOrigins cannot contain  the special value "*" since that cannot be set on the "Access-Control-Allow-Origin" response  header. 
原创 2021-06-08 11:41:19
721阅读
  • 1
  • 2
  • 3
  • 4
  • 5